[PATCH v3] libiberty: Use posix_spawn in pex-unix when available.
Hi, This patch implements pex_unix_exec_child using posix_spawn when available. This should especially benefit recent macOS (where vfork just calls fork), but should have equivalent or faster performance on all platforms. In addition, the implementation is substantially simpler than the vfork+exec code path. Tested on x86_64-linux. v2: Fix error handling (previously the function would be run twice in case of error), and don't use a macro that changes control flow. v3: Match file style for error-handling blocks, don't close in/out/errdes on error, and check close() for errors. libiberty/ * configure.ac (AC_CHECK_HEADERS): Add spawn.h. (checkfuncs): Add posix_spawn, posix_spawnp. (AC_CHECK_FUNCS): Add posix_spawn, posix_spawnp. * aclocal.m4, configure, config.in: Rebuild. * pex-unix.c [HAVE_POSIX_SPAWN] (pex_unix_exec_child): New function.
